Yuri Borissowitsch Pantjuchow ( Russian Юрий Борисович Пантюхов ; born March 15, 1931 in Kolomna , † October 22, 1981 in Moscow ) was a Russian - Soviet ice hockey player .
Career
First Pantjuchow Bandy played at Dynamo Moscow before he switched to ice hockey.
During his career, Yuri Pantjuchow played with Krylya Sowetow Moscow , WWS Moscow and CSKA Moscow . In total, he scored 121 goals in 230 games in the Soviet league . In the 1961/62 season he let his career with SKA Leningrad end. After retiring, he worked as a trainer at SKA MWO, the sports lottery and in the management of the Zenit sports club.
Yuri Pantjuchow died in October 1982 and was buried in the Danilov Cemetery in Moscow.
International
On January 9, 1955, Yuri Pantjuchow was in a game against Sweden for the first time for the Soviet national team on the ice. His international career was crowned with a gold medal at the 1956 Winter Olympics . In recognition of this success, he was then awarded the title of Honored Master of Sport .
On March 15, 1959, he played his last international match. For the national team, he scored a total of 32 goals in 68 international matches.
